How Commercial Water Removal Works

When you call us for commercial water removal, you can expect a thorough process that ensures your property is restored to its pre-damage state. We’ll assess the damage, extract the water, dry and dehumidify the area, and finally, repair and rebuild any damaged structures. Our process is designed to reduce downtime and get you back to business quickly.

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age, identify the source of the water, and create a customized plan to restore your property. We’ll explain the process, answer your questions, and provide a detailed estimate.

Water Extraction

Our technicians will use advanced equipment to extract the water from your property, including w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and truck-mounted extractors.

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ough cleanup.

Repair and Rebuilding

Once the area is dry, our team will repair and rebuild any damaged structures, including walls, ceilings, and floors.

Commercial Water Removal Cost In Orefield, PA

The cost of commercial water removal in Orefield, PA, var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Repair and Rebuilding $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of repairs, materials used
Assessment and Planning $0 – $500 Complexity of damage, time spent assessing
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 Type and duration of equipment rental
Insurance Claims Help $0 – $1,000 Complexity of claims process, time spent assisting

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
